Israel
antalya, antalya, Turkey
Saint Petersburg, Saint Petersburg, Russian Federation
Moscow, Moscow, Russian Federation
Lyubertsy, Moscow Province, Russian Federation
Łódź, Łódź Voivodeship, Poland
Tel Aviv-Yafo, Tel Aviv District, Israel
Be'er Sheva, South District, Israel
Saint-Rémy-de-Provence, Provence-Alpes-Côte d'Azur, France